Peru Unveils $24 Billion Irrigation Project
Peru's Agriculture Minister Angel Manero announced a $24 billion investment to expand irrigation. This initiative aims to increase the country's farmland by one million hectares, marking a significant boost to agricultural productivity and economic growth in Peru.

In a significant move to bolster agricultural productivity, Peru's Agriculture Minister Angel Manero unveiled a comprehensive $24 billion irrigation project. The initiative is set to transform the Andean nation's agricultural landscape by adding an impressive one million hectares of farmland.
The ambitious package announced on Monday underscores the government's commitment to enhancing irrigation infrastructure, a crucial step as the nation seeks to capitalize on its agricultural potential. The expansion effort is expected to not only improve crop yields but also stimulate economic growth in rural areas.
As the government rolls out this expansive plan, stakeholders in the agriculture sector are poised to witness increased opportunities and productivity, aligning with Peru's broader goals of sustainable development and economic advancement.
